Michigan woman wins nearly $800K on lottery ticket she bought on Fourth of July camping trip

An Oakland County woman turned a Fourth of July camping trip in northern Michigan into a massive payday when she won a nearly $800,000 Fantasy 5 jackpot from the Michigan Lottery. The 67-year-old woman, who wishes to remain anonymous, won $792,990 by matching the Fantasy 5 numbers in the July 3 drawing: 08-19-27-31-39. "I went up north on a camping trip for Fourth of July weekend and bought a Fantasy 5 ticket while I was at the store," said the player in a news release. "The next morning, on the Fourth of July, I checked the winning numbers on and was so excited when I found out I won the big jackpot! I told some of the people at the surrounding campsites, so it was fun to celebrate with everyone." The Oakland County resident purchased her winning ticket at the Meijer store in Gaylord. With her winnings, the lucky winner plans to start college funds for her grandchildren, make home repairs and take her family to Disney. Each Fantasy 5 play is $1, and for an extra $1 per play, players can add EZmatch to a ticket, giving players the chance to win $500 instantly. Players can add Double Play to Fantasy 5 tickets for an extra $1 per play, which affords them a second chance to win up to $110,000 in the Double Play drawing, according to the Michigan Lottery. Drawings are held every night at 7:29 p.m. Tickets can be bought until 7:08 p.m. on the day of the drawing.

Michigan Lottery player takes $865,124 jackpot in Lucky Clover game

A Tuscola County woman has won a $865,124 jackpot in the Michigan Lottery Lucky Clover game with what she originally thought was a losing ticket. The lottery announced the win Wednesday, saying the ticket was purchased June 28 at Millington Inn on State Road in Millington, near Saginaw. The 65-year-old woman, who chose to remain anonymous, recently visited Michigan Lottery headquarters to claim her prize. "I buy a Fast Cash ticket almost every day, and I bought this one while I was out to eat one night," the player said. "I didn't think I won anything, but I asked the bartender to scan the ticket for me. She said it came back with a message to file a claim, so I would have to call the Lottery office Monday morning to figure out what's going on. "The next morning, I got a call from the bartender telling me they sold a jackpot winning Fast Cash ticket the night before, so to look my ticket over again because that may be why the message to file a claim came up. My first thought was that she was lying to me because I thought it was impossible that I may have won. When I looked my ticket over again and saw I really was the big winner, I couldn't help but cry!" The Michigan Lottery Fast Cash games are a series of instant-win games, with a progressive jackpot that increases until someone wins it. The game's tickets range in cost from $2 per play up to $30 per play.

Michigan Lottery player has a $1 million Powerball prize waiting

A $1 million prize is awaiting a Michigan Lottery player who made an online entry to Monday's Powerball drawing. The Michigan Lottery said the lucky player matched five white balls in Monday's drawing to win $1 million: 08-12-45-46-63. The red number was 24. "A lucky Michigander woke up this morning to news that they won $1 million playing Powerball at said Lottery Commissioner Suzanna Shkreli. "Winning $1 million would be a dream come true for many Lottery players, and I want to be the first to congratulate the player on their big win!" Although there was a "match 5" winner in Michigan and a "match 5 plus power play" winner in Arizona, no one won the Powerball jackpot that required a perfect match on the ticket to all white numbers and the additional red number. All lower-tier prizes in the Powerball game are set amounts. The jackpots grow until someone wins the top prize. The next Powerball drawing is Wednesday night, with an estimated jackpot of $264 million. Tickets are $2 in most participating states, including Michigan. A "power play" option that can boost the lower-level prize amounts is an additional $1. Michigan's winner should contact the Lottery's Player Relations division at 844-917-6325 to make arrangements to claim the prize. Powerball prizes must be claimed within one year from the date of the drawing.

Michigan man wins $500,000 lottery prize due to unavailable ticket

A Michigan man won a $500,000 lottery prize after the store he visited was sold out of the scratch-off ticket he originally intended to buy. File Photo by John Angelillo/UPI | License Photo July 10 (UPI) -- A Michigan man won a $500,000 lottery prize thanks to his local store being sold out of the ticket he had originally intended to buy. The 57-year-old Tuscola County man told Michigan Lottery officials he had a specific scratch-off game in mind when he visited the Speedway on West Caro Road in Caro. "I stopped at the gas station to buy a Triple Red 777s ticket, but they were sold out, so I told the cashier to give me a Detroit Tigers ticket instead," the player recalled. "It was hard to believe when I saw I'd won $500,000, but after looking the ticket over several times, I told myself it must be real." The man said he needed a second opinion to fully believe his luck. "I signed the ticket and took it back into the store to have the cashier check it. After she scanned it, she handed it back and said: 'Looks like you have to go to Lansing for this one!' Winning $500,000 is an answered prayer and still hasn't fully sunk in." The winner said his prize money will go toward helping his family and investing.

Lottery player was afraid to check MI ticket. When he did, he ‘started screaming'

A 50-year-old man bought a store's last few tickets for a Michigan lottery game, then discovered he won a huge top prize. The Wayne County man, who chose to remain anonymous, won big playing the $4,000,000 Winner game, state lottery officials said in a July 9 news release. When stopping into a market in Ann Arbor, the lucky player noticed none of the three jackpot prizes, each worth $4 million, had been won — so he bought the store's last three tickets for a shot to win. At first, he scratched off only the barcodes on the tickets, then scanned them with the lottery app, officials said. One of the tickets triggered a message indicating it was a winner — but how much, the app didn't say. 'One of the tickets came back with a message to file a claim, so I knew I had to have won one of the big prizes, but I was too nervous to scratch the ticket,' he told lottery officials. 'The next day, once I calmed down a bit, I scanned the ticket on the Michigan Lottery app and started screaming when $4 million came up on the screen! It was unreal.' The man went to lottery headquarters in Lansing and picked up his winnings, officials said, adding that he opted for a $2.7 million lump sum payment instead of the full amount paid out in annual installments. 'With his winnings, he plans to pay off his home, take a trip, and then save the remainder,' officials said.
